Output 59e2c9675eab1ffef5a2ea151e60cb3303add6e8b17e8ec21b8b3e0469477a42:1

value
42098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 240c8c7dee77886c0761c12497ae2e67aaddac65 OP_EQUAL
address
34ydHMZYmxZ5GXwFFEVHo6wWxHVcnN6X41
transaction
59e2c9675eab1ffef5a2ea151e60cb3303add6e8b17e8ec21b8b3e0469477a42